Address 20.46236306 DCR

DsjbxvU7Rbax74ANVs9VnamtiJiQxYRZuMj

Confirmed

Total Received20.46236306 DCR
Total Sent0 DCR
Final Balance20.46236306 DCR
No. Transactions1

Transactions

DsjbxvU7Rbax74ANVs9VnamtiJiQxYRZuMj0.07974776 DCR ×
DsjbxvU7Rbax74ANVs9VnamtiJiQxYRZuMj20.3826153 DCR ×
DsexsySnvGVDMnVZJr3LEgDXamANiQdrJJY457.79520148 DCR
Fee: 0.00289 DCR
880295 Confirmations478.25756454 DCR